  3. Not sure what fancy stats they are referencing, but holy cow!  Excerpt from an Athletic team preview of the Sabres…

     

    We’ll be quick about this: Thompson, for all his offensive gifts, could be one of the least effective defensive players in the league. Like, bottom five. Sixth from the basement, specifically. One team analyst compared his play to the legendary Alex Ovechkin/disconnected Xbox controllerGIF.

    Thompson’s overall projected Defensive Rating is, in fact, below 38-year-old Ovechkin’s. It’s below Patrick Kane’s. It’s also too close to too many of his teammates’ — Skinner, JJ Peterka, Cozens and Henri Jokiharju are all in the bottom 30 as well, among waves of Anaheim Ducks and Montreal Canadiens and Columbus Blue Jackets. For a team with playoff aspirations, that’s a terrible sign. Granato is a good coach who seems to be facing a clear challenge: getting his team to tighten up in one end, at least a little, without sacrificing its identity. Given their other year-over-year improvements, it’s possible. It’s also necessary, especially in an Atlantic Division featuring a couple of other on-the-rise teams.
